Rong'an Hall.

When the old lady received this news, she was also greatly shocked.

She knew very well that Third Sister's personality was quite similar to Zhao's; she wasn't virtuous or generous enough, and she didn't have much cunning in her heart, making her most suitable to be someone's daughter-in-law. Although Third Sister was also reasonable and intelligent, if she were to become the matriarch of the royal family or the mistress of the Prince's mansion in the future, Third Sister's methods and schemes would not be enough.

The fact that San Niang is now in such a stalemate is perhaps due to her own problems.

But when the time comes, the most urgent task is to solve San Niang's predicament.

As the Dowager was quietly contemplating in her inner room, she heard Zhao's voice coming from outside.

"Is the Dowager Madam still resting?" Zhao asked anxiously. "I have urgent business with the Dowager Madam!"

Before the maids could relay the message, the Grand Madam's calm and collected voice came from the inner room. "Come in."

Without waiting for anyone to lift the curtain, Zhao strode in herself.

"Mother!" Zhao said anxiously, "Li has given birth to my son-in-law's eldest son by a concubine, what are we going to do, Third Mother!"

The old lady gestured for her to sit down and said in a deep voice, "What's the panic? You're supposed to be Third Sister's mother, and you're already flustered at a time like this. Doesn't that make Third Sister even more indecisive? I'm asking you, have you prepared the gifts for the Prince's Mansion?"

Zhao nodded reluctantly.

"Madam Li entered the manor with her belly almost ready to give birth. You and Third Sister should have been prepared long ago. She is very likely to give birth to the eldest son born out of wedlock, otherwise she wouldn't have been so careful to conceal it and only returned when she was almost due." The Grand Madam reminded Madam Zhao, "Being flustered now will not only be useless, but will also throw you into disarray!"

After hearing what the old lady said, Zhao Shi slightly composed herself.

"Mother, what do you think we should do now?" Madam Zhao thought of Third Sister's current predicament and felt powerless to help. Although she deeply resented the Grand Madam's concealment, she had to admit the Grand Madam's shrewdness. Third Sister's matter was the most important thing now, and for her daughter's sake, she was willing to bow to the Grand Madam!

After listening, the old lady did not answer directly, but instead asked what gifts were prepared to be sent.

Zhao was getting anxious, but she had no choice but to patiently answer each question. Before she finished speaking, she saw the Grand Madam frown.

"Is that all?" The old lady's voice revealed a hint of displeasure.

Zhao felt wronged. Those were the same gifts she had given for the third-day celebration of the eldest grandson of the Duke's mansion, and even more generous! Why did the Grand Madam still think it was too little?

"Two months ago, the combined celebrations for the eldest grandson of the Duke of Qingguo's family and the eldest grandson of the Marquis of Ningyuan's family, including their third-day and full-month celebrations, amounted to about this much." Zhao defended herself, "Although Li's son is the eldest son, he is still only a son born out of wedlock!"

"If it were Third Sister who gave birth to a legitimate son this time, would you still offer this little something to get rid of her?" The Grand Madam's expression was not good.

A hint of disdain flashed in Zhao's eyes. She couldn't help but say, "How can that be the same? If it's Third Sister's child, he will naturally be the eldest son of the legitimate wife, the future heir of the Marquis's mansion... His status is extremely precious. How can Li's son compare?"

The implication was that she had already promoted Li and her son, so what else could the Grand Madam be dissatisfied with?

"Foolish!" The old lady slammed her hand on the kang table, making the incense burner on it seem to tremble. She looked sharply at Zhao Shi and said coldly, "No matter how noble their status is, can they be the same as Li Shi's son? In the future, Li Shi's son will have to call Third Sister 'Mother'!"

"What you took out was to save face for Third Sister!"

Zhao was completely bewildered.

"In your opinion, how should Third Sister resolve the current predicament?" The Grand Madam glanced at Zhao Shi and asked.

Feeling guilty under the Grand Madam's gaze, Zhao said in a slightly unsteady voice, "The best thing would be to raise that child by his side... or to bring two trusted servants to the young master's side. After all, children born to people he knows well are more likely to be well-behaved..."

Her voice grew softer and softer, and she herself realized that what she was about to say was unreliable.

The old lady sighed heavily.

It's impossible to get angry with someone like Zhao Shi. Third Sister is very important to the Marquis's mansion, and her status as the Crown Prince's wife must be maintained.

"This time, we must prepare a lavish amount for the third-day celebration of Li's son," the Dowager said solemnly. "Just prepare the same things as we did for the Third Madam's eldest son."

Zhao's face was filled with disbelief.

"That...that's too much!" Zhao thought for a moment, then said with some pain, "He's just a son born out of wedlock..."

The old lady was disappointed in him.

At this point, there's no need to worry about the value of the gift; what's important is to resolve the current predicament.

"The best solution right now is to take this child to Third Madam's side and raise him!" the Grand Madam said patiently. "On the day of the child's third-day celebration, we will send generous gifts and invite important relatives to attend. On the day of the child's full moon celebration, we will invite all relatives to attend, and treat this child as Third Madam's legitimate son—"

Zhao's eyes widened suddenly; she understood what the Grand Madam meant.

Without making a sound, she announced to everyone that Third Sister valued this child highly. She and Yun Shen had been married for four years without children, so it was normal for her to long for one. It was also normal for Third Sister to like a son born out of wedlock. If Third Sister wanted to raise the child herself, that would be perfectly normal.

If many relatives from Third Sister's family come and bring generous gifts, it's practically an implicit agreement that the child will be registered under Third Sister's name in the future, hence such a grand display.

In this way, any reasonable person, including Princess Consort Yi and Prince Heir, would be happy.

The custody of the eldest son naturally fell to the Third Sister. Although Li was a distant relative of the concubine, she had followed the heir without any official status. Now, she was pregnant and returning to the mansion. Although she had given birth to the eldest son, it was still not a good look for her.

If Third Sister were to relent and take the child into her care, and treat the child well, then the Princess Consort and the Heir Apparent would have no further complaints.

After a moment of silence, Zhao gritted her teeth and agreed.

It wasn't that she was entirely distressed about the things; more importantly, she was afraid that Third Sister was stubborn and wouldn't change her mind in a short time.

Lady Zhao left, looking worried.

Will Third Sister cooperate properly?
